根据给定规则将树转化为二叉树后,根节点A的右子树的根节点是哪个?
答案解析
核心考点说明:本题考察将普通树转化为二叉树的规则,关键在于理解兄弟节点之间的连接方式以及如何区分左子树和右子树。
解题思路分析:根据题目给出的转换规则,树的每个节点都只有一个左孩子,其为原树中该节点的第一个孩子,而右孩子为该节点的兄弟。按照此规则,转化时,A节点的子节点B成为A的左孩子,而A的兄弟节点(如果有)会成为A的右孩子。由于A没有兄弟节点,所以A的右子树为空。
选项分析:
A. B: B是A的左子树的根节点,错误。
B. C: C不是A的兄弟节点,根据规则C应是B的兄弟节点。
C. E: E 是B的子节点,根据规则E应是B的左孩子。
D. NULL: 根据转换规则,A没有兄弟节点,所以A的右子树为空。
易错点提醒:容易将普通树的子节点直接对应到二叉树的左、右子树,忽略兄弟节点之间的关系。
正确答案:D